139 miles north of Sydney, Australia lies Mount Wingen, a large hill that’s been smoldering and belching smoke from its summit for thousands of years.
Commonly called “Burning Mountain”, Mount Wingen isn’t a volcano as you might expect.
The never-ending supply of smoke and ash are actually produced by an underground coal fire that simply will not go out.
